The HomeGrid Home Battery Complete Review | EnergySage
HomeGrid''s Compact series comes in one size, with 5.12 kilowatt-hours (kWh) of usable capacity. Its Stack''d series can include between two and eight modules, with each module having 4.8 kWh of usable capacity (so your battery could be anywhere from 9.6 to 38.4 kWh in total). How to Measure Battery Capacity
The formula for determining the energy capacity of a lithium battery is: Energy Capacity (Wh) = Voltage (V) x Amp-Hours (Ah) For example, if a lithium battery has a voltage of 11.1V and an amp-hour rating of 3,500mAh, its energy capacity would be: Energy Capacity (Wh) = 11.1V x 3.5Ah = 38.85Wh.

SolarEdge Home Battery Review: A Good Battery From a Big Solar
The SolarEdge Home Battery has a fairly standard usable capacity of 9.7 kWh. You can stack up to three battery units for a total of 29.1 kWh of energy storage capacity.
